Kristi Funk (born September 22, 1969) is an American breast cancer surgeon recognized for her surgical treatment of celebrities Angelina Jolie and Sheryl Crow.[1][2] Funk cofounded the Pink Lotus Breast Center in 2007 and opened its Beverly Hills location in 2009 with her husband, entrepreneur and venture capitalist Andy Funk.
On May 14, 2013, the same day Jolie publicly disclosed in a New York Times op-ed her BRCA mutation status and the prophylactic mastectomy she underwent earlier that year, Funk released a blog post about Jolie's procedure in which she outlined the stages of surveillance and treatment that were followed in her case.[3][4][5]
